ConfigurationExtensions Třída

Definice

Rozšiřující metody pro třídy konfigurace.

public ref class ConfigurationExtensions abstract sealed
public static class ConfigurationExtensions
type ConfigurationExtensions = class
Public Module ConfigurationExtensions
Dědičnost
ConfigurationExtensions

Metody

Add<TSource>(IConfigurationBuilder, Action<TSource>)

Přidá nový zdroj konfigurace.

AddUserSecrets(IConfigurationBuilder)

Přidá zdroj konfigurace tajných kódů uživatelů. Vyhledá v sestavení z GetEntryAssembly() instance UserSecretsIdAttribute.

AddUserSecrets(IConfigurationBuilder, Assembly)

Přidá zdroj konfigurace tajných kódů uživatelů.

AddUserSecrets(IConfigurationBuilder, String)

Přidá zdroj konfigurace tajných kódů uživatele se zadaným ID tajných kódů.

AddUserSecrets<T>(IConfigurationBuilder)

Přidá zdroj konfigurace tajných kódů uživatelů. Vyhledá v sestavení, které obsahuje typ T , instanci UserSecretsIdAttribute.

AsEnumerable(IConfiguration)

Získejte výčet dvojic klíč-hodnota v rámci objektu IConfiguration.

AsEnumerable(IConfiguration, Boolean)

Získá výčet párů klíč-hodnota v rámci IConfiguration.

Exists(IConfigurationSection)

Určuje, zda má oddíl nebo má podřízené Value položky.

GetConnectionString(IConfiguration, String)

Načte hodnotu se zadaným klíčem z oddílu ConnectionStrings zdroje konfigurace. Volání této metody je zkratka pro GetSection("ConnectionStrings")[name].

GetRequiredSection(IConfiguration, String)

Získá pododdíl konfigurace, který má zadaný klíč.

Platí pro